PackageDescription | scripts to make the life of a Debian Package maintainer easier Contains the following scripts, dependencies/recommendations shown in brackets afterwards: . - annotate-output: run a command and prepend time and stream (O for stdout, E for stderr) for every line of output - archpath: print tla/Bazaar package names [tla | bazaar] - bts: a command-line tool for manipulating the BTS [www-browser, libauthen-sasl-perl, libnet-smtp-ssl-perl, libsoap-lite-perl, libwww-perl, bsd-mailx | mailx | mailutils] - build-rdeps: Searches for all packages that build-depend on a given package [dctrl-tools] - chdist: tool to easily play with several distributions [dctrl-tools] - checkbashisms: check whether a /bin/sh script contains any common bash-specific contructs - cowpoke: upload a Debian source package to a cowbuilder host and build it, optionally also signing and uploading the result to an incoming queue [ssh-client] - cvs-debi, cvs-debc: wrappers around debi and debc respectively (see below) which allow them to be called from the CVS working directory. [cvs-buildpackage] - cvs-debrelease: wrapper around debrelease which allows it to be called from the CVS working directory. [cvs-buildpackage, dupload | dput, ssh-client] - cvs-debuild: A wrapper for cvs-buildpackage to use debuild as its package building program. [cvs-buildpackage, fakeroot, lintian, gnupg] - dcmd: run a given command replacing the name of a .changes or .dsc file with each of the files referenced therein - dcontrol: remotely query package and source control files for all Debian distributions. [liburl-perl, libwww-perl] - dd-list: given a list of packages, pretty-print it ordered by maintainer - debc: display the contents of just-built .debs - debchange/dch: automagically add entries to debian/changelog files [libparse-debcontrol-perl, libsoap-lite-perl, lsb-release] - debcheckout: checkout the development repository of a Debian package - debclean: purge a Debian source tree [fakeroot] - debcommit: commit changes to cvs, svn, svk, tla, bzr, git, or hg, basing commit message on changelog [cvs | subversion | svk | tla | bzr | git-core | mercurial] - debdiff: compare two versions of a Debian package to check for added and removed files [wdiff, patchutils] - debi: install a just-built package - debpkg: dpkg wrapper to be able to manage/test packages without su - debrelease: wrapper around dupload or dput [dupload | dput, ssh-client] - debsign, debrsign: sign a .changes/.dsc pair without needing any of the rest of the package to be present; can sign the pair remotely or fetch the pair from a remote machine for signing [gnupg, debian-keyring, ssh-client] - debsnap: grab packages from http://snapshot.debian.net [wget] - debuild: wrapper to build a package without having to su or worry about how to invoke dpkg to build using fakeroot. Also deals with common environment problems, umask etc. [fakeroot, lintian, gnupg] - deb-reversion: increases a binary package version number and repacks the archive - desktop2menu: produce a skeleton menu file from a freedesktop.org desktop file [libfile-desktopentry-perl] - dget: downloads Debian source and binary packages [wget | curl] - dpkg-depcheck, dpkg-genbuilddeps: determine the packages used during the build of a Debian package; useful for determining the Build-Depends control field needed [build-essential, strace] - diff2patches: extract patches from a .diff.gz file placing them under debian/ or, if present, debian/patches [patchutils] - dscverify: verify the integrity of a Debian package from the .changes or .dsc files [gnupg, debian-keyring, libdigest-md5-perl] - getbuildlog: download package build logs from Debian auto-builders [wget] - grep-excuses: grep the update_excuses.html file for your packages [libterm-size-perl, wget] - licensecheck: attempt to determine the license of source files - list-unreleased: searches for unreleased packages - manpage-alert: locate binaries without corresponding manpages [man-db] - mass-bug: mass-file bug reports [bsd-mailx | mailx | mailutils] - mergechanges: merge .changes files from a package built on different architectures - mk-build-deps: Given a package name and/or control file, generate a binary package which may be installed to satisfy the build-dependencies of the given packages. [equivs] - namecheck: Check project names are not already taken. - nmudiff: mail a diff of the current package against the previous version to the BTS to assist in tracking NMUs [patchutils, mutt] - plotchangelog: view a nice plot of the data in a changelog file [libtimedate-perl, gnuplot] - pts-subscribe: subscribe to the PTS for a limited period of time [bsd-mailx | mailx | mailutils, at] - rc-alert: list installed packages which have release-critical bugs [wget] - rmadison: remotely query the Debian archive database about packages [wget | curl, liburi-perl] - svnpath: print svn repository paths [subversion] - tagpending: runs from a Debian source tree and tags bugs that are to be closed in the latest changelog as pending. [libsoap-lite-perl] - transition-check: Check a list of source packages for involvement in transitions for which uploads to unstable are currently blocked [libwww-perl, libyaml-syck-perl] - uscan: scan upstream sites for new releases of packages [libcrypt-ssleay-perl, libwww-perl, unzip] - uupdate: integrate upstream changes into a source package [patch] - whodepends: check which maintainers' packages depend on a package - who-uploads: determine the most recent uploaders of a package to the Debian archive [gnupg, debian-keyring, debian-maintainers, wget] - wnpp-alert: list installed packages which are orphaned or up for adoption [wget] - wnpp-check: check whether there is an open request for packaging or intention to package bug for a package [wget] . Also included are a set of example mail filters for filtering mail from Debian mailing lists using exim, procmail, etc. |
